When I checked in at the hotel Wednesday I had to give my CC for my incidentals (room service, phone, etc.) I confirmed at that time that they had me set up for my employer to pay for the room and they said yes - this was JUST incidentals. OK fine - I gave my Visa check card b/c we don't have cc's. At 4:30 am today when I checked out my bill said $577.31. I talked to the guy at the desk and he fixed it supposedly making my incidentals $16.73 (heck yeah I ordered room service in a 5 star hotel without my DH and kids!!). That's what he processed on my card, that's what the receipt says.
Well, tonight I looged on to my bank account and they charged $16.73 at 4:36 am and then $577.31 at 6:30 am!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
I called the hotel and they said that there was nothing they could do about it without authorization from my corporate office. Well - it's Saturday! I called my boss and left her a message as well.
Here's the kicker - I know from experience that it takes seconds for your account to get charged when you use a visa check card - but it takes at least 3 business days for your account to receive a credit! So -when corporate oks it Monday I still won't get it back until after Thanksgiving. If I choose to expense it, it won't get reimbursed until my next pay date which isn't until the 30th.
SO - #1 - we can't go back to Indiana for Thanksgiving now and #2 - I can't even really do a good grocery shopping trip to have a decent Thanksgiving here! To a family of 6 - that's a heck of a lot of $$ that I'm out for the time being!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!

If you have Bank of America or another big bank you can call anytime 24 hrs and dispute the charge. Even if it is debit they ran it as credit so it falls under the 24 hr dispute rule. This way the bank will put the money back in your account in a day and the details can be worked out later.
When you dispute be sure to tell them these were unauthorized charges.

Also, if the hotel decides to refund to you card and rebill to the company, have them call your visa check card first. I have done this before. They can call and get a special authorization that puts them money back immediatly, but they have to call before they process the refund.
